The new Honda Jazz entry level 1.2-litre S is £9,990 but the SE with air con and 15-inch alloys from £10,990 is expected to be more popular.
Of the 1.4-litre models, from £11,490, the ES with 15-inch alloy wheels, air con, chilled glovebox and VSA is tipped as best-seller. The 1.4 EX with 16-inch alloys, auto lights and wipers, climate control and panoramic sunroof is £12,790. Manuals go on sale in October, the i-SHIFT auto in January.

SEAT is expanding its new Ibiza at the forthcoming Paris Motor Show, with the fire-breathing Cupra and ultra-green Ecomotive models.
The Cupra uses a 180 PS 1.4-litre petrol engine, featuring not only a turbocharger but also a supercharger and seven speed box while Ecomotive is equipped with a frugal 80 PS 1.4 TDI engine with DPF diesel particulate filter and emits just 99gkm CO2.
